Hvar is a harbor on the Croatian island of the same name, situated in the Adriatic Sea. It primarily handles passenger vessels, with depths allowing for a maximum draft of approximately 5.01 meters.

Background
Hvar is a Croatian island in the Adriatic Sea, located off the Dalmatian coast, lying between the islands of Brač, Vis and Korčula. Approximately 68 kilometres (42.25 mi) long, with a high east–west ridge of Mesozoic limestone and dolomite, the island of Hvar is unusual in the area for having a large fertile coastal plain, and fresh water springs. Its hillsides are covered in pine forests, with vineyards, olive groves, fruit orchards and lavender fields in the agricultural areas. The climate is characterized by mild winters, and warm summers with many hours of sunshine. The island has 10,678 residents according to the 2021 census, making it the fourth most populated of the Croatian islands.

How do I navigate the approach to the Port of Hvar?+
The approach to Hvar is supported by 5 navigation aids within 50 nautical miles. The nearest is Gališnik Lighthouse at 0.3 NM to the SSW. Other aids include Pokonji Dol (1 NM SE), Pelegrin (3.5 NM WNW), Otok Vodnjak Veli (5.6 NM W), Rt Stončica {Punta Promontore} (10 NM SW). Mariners should consult the relevant chart and List of Lights for full approach details.
